About Faming Wang

Faming Wang is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Physiology, Materials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, having authored 34 papers that have together received 2.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nanoplatforms for cancer theranostics (15 papers), Advanced Nanomaterials in Catalysis (11 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(9 papers), Click Chemistry and Applications (5 papers), Nanocluster Synthesis and Applications (4 papers), Metal-Organic Frameworks: Synthesis and Applications (3 papers), Graphene and Nanomaterials Applications (3 papers) and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(1.8k citations), Biomedical Engineering (1.6k citations), Inorganic Chemistry (435 citations), Biomaterials (289 citations) and Molecular Biology (961 citations). Faming Wang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Pakistan. Frequent co-authors include Jinsong Ren, Xiaogang Qu, Zhenzhen Wang, Zhengwei Liu, Yan Zhang, Yan Zhang, Chaoqun Liu, Lihua Kang, Yanyan Huang and Kai Dong. Their work appears in journals such as Chemical Communications, Journal of Materials Chemistry B, Small, ACS Nano and Biomaterials.
